After exposure, your employer must provide you with a copy of the evaluating healthcare professional's written opinion within 15
harkovskaia [1695]

Answer:

The report must encompass:

1. Confirmation of whether the exposed employee was advised to receive the hepatitis B vaccination

2. Indication of whether the employee accepted the vaccination

3. Details on whether the healthcare provider informed the worker of the evaluation outcomes, including any additional medical issues that arose from exposure to blood or other potentially infectious materials that required treatment or further assessment.

Explanation:

The inquiry pertains to "Bloodborne Pathogen Exposure Incidents." Workers in the healthcare sector are required to report any exposure to bloodborne pathogens (like hepatitis). This measure helps to safeguard the worker against infection while also preventing potential transmission to others. Following this, a medical examination will take place to assess the risk of infection. After test results are obtained, they should also be communicated to the worker. A healthcare professional will review the findings and provide a written opinion within 15 days that will include the specified information above.

No additional details outside of those mentioned will be included in the written opinion.
